加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zhanzhang.cn/)- 事件网格、研发安全、负载均衡、云连接、大数据!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ix环境配置全攻略与深度优化实用步骤指南

发布时间:2025-05-23 13:38:16 所属栏目:Unix 来源:DaWei
导读: 详细指南:Unix环境配置全攻略及深度优化步骤

在构建和维护Unix环境时,从基础配置到深度优化,每一步都至关重要。本文将为你提供一个清晰、系统的指南。

一、基础配置

1. 安装Unix操作系

详细指南:Unix环境配置全攻略及深度优化步骤

在构建和维护Unix环境时,从基础配置到深度优化,每一步都至关重要。本文将为你提供一个清晰、系统的指南。

一、基础配置

1. 安装Unix操作系统:选择合适的Unix发行版,如Ubuntu或Debian,并通过虚拟机如VMware或直接在物理硬件上安装。安装后,进行必要的系统更新。

2. 配置环境变量:编辑用户的配置文件(如.bashrc或.bash_profile),添加或修改PATH变量,以便在任何目录下访问编译器、工具等。例如,使用vi编辑器添加“export PATH=$PATH:/path/to/new/directory”并保存,然后通过“source ~/.bashrc”使配置生效。

3. 安装开发工具:对于编程环境,安装必要的编译工具链、代码编辑器(如Vim或VSCode)、调试器(如GDB)、版本控制系统(如Git)等。

二、深度优化

1. 硬件优化:在可能的情况下,选择高性能硬件,如多核处理器、大容量内存、高速SSD硬盘和网络接口,以提升系统处理能力。

2. 操作系统内核调整:通过修改/etc/sysctl.conf等配置文件,调整TCP/IP参数、文件系统缓冲区大小等,以优化网络带宽和文件系统性能。

3. 使用缓存技术:部署Memcached、Redis等缓存技术,减少对硬盘的读写操作,提高数据读取速度和系统性能。

4. 性能监控与日志分析:使用top、htop、vmstat、iostat、sar等工具,定期监控CPU、内存、磁盘和网络使用情况;定期分析系统日志和应用程序日志,了解系统运行状态和潜在问题。

5. 使用Nice值调整任务优先级:对于重要的系统任务,可以使用Nice值提高其优先级,确保这些任务在资源竞争中获得优先处理。

2025规划图AI提供,仅供参考

6. 负载均衡与流量控制:在高并发场景下,使用负载均衡器如Nginx或HAProxy分散请求;使用tc等工具配置流量控制策略,确保网络资源合理分配。

通过上述步骤,你可以构建一个高效、稳定的Unix环境,满足各种业务需求。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章